H.R. 2942 (112th)
To direct the Chief of the Army Corps of Engineers to revise the Missouri River Mainstem Reservoir System Master Water Control Manual to ensure greater storage capacity to prevent serious downstream flooding.

Summary
Directs the Chief of the Army Corps of Engineers to revise the Missouri River Mainstem Reservoir System Master Water Control Manual to ensure that the System's flood control storage allocation has been: (1) recalculated so that it is based on the vacated space required to control the largest flood experienced in the System and the associated serious downstream flooding; and (2) adjusted, prior to each runoff season, such that the space allocated for flood control purposes in the Exclusive Flood Control Zone and the Annual Flood Control and Multiple Use Regulation Zone is increased by an amount necessary to ensure that the storage capacity of the two zones is adequate to avoid contributing to serious downstream flooding.
